Housing costs in Newark?
A typical home costs $405,300, which is 19.9% more expensive than the national average of $338,100 and 6.2% less expensive than the average New Jersey home, at $432,100. Renting a two-bedroom unit in Newark costs $1,440 per month, which is 15.8% cheaper than the national average of $1,710 and 50.7% cheaper than the state average of $2,170.

Can I afford Newark?
To live comfortably in Newark (zip 07112), New Jersey, a minimum annual income of $77,760 for a family, and $48,000 for a single person is recommended.
